Smoke damage after a fire in Sacramento can range from light soot deposits to deeply embedded odors and staining on surfaces. Dry smoke, often associated with smoldering fires, leaves fine, powdery soot that can penetrate porous materials like drywall and upholstery. Wet smoke, from flaming fires, is sticky, greasy, and harder to remove. Professionals use techniques like alkaline cleaners and thermal fogging to neutralize acidic residues and eliminate pervasive smoke odors throughout your Sacramento home.

The duration of fire damage restoration in Sacramento varies greatly depending on the severity of the fire and the extent of the damage. Minor incidents might take a few days to a week for basic cleaning and deodorizing. More significant structural damage requiring reconstruction could extend to several weeks or even months. Factors like material replacement, drying times, and insurance approvals all influence the overall timeline for your Sacramento property.
Much can often be salvaged after a house fire in Sacramento with professional intervention. Structural elements like wood framing, concrete, and some masonry may be salvageable after thorough cleaning and inspection. Contents such as furniture, appliances, and personal belongings can often be restored through specialized cleaning and deodorizing techniques.
